How It Works
- 1Site & waterway assessment
We evaluate bottom conditions, water depth, tidal range, and riparian lines specific to your property.
- 2Custom design
We design dock footprint, decking material, and lift accommodations around your boat and how you use the water.
- 3Permitting
We prepare and submit permit packages to the relevant county, state (FDEP), and Army Corps of Engineers offices.
- 4Construction
Our crews build to the approved plans using marine-grade materials rated for Florida saltwater exposure.
- 5Final inspection & handoff
We walk the finished dock with you and provide documentation for your records and insurance.
